The Punjab government has announced plans to establish a network of public schools modeled after the standards of Aitchison College, aiming to provide students across the province with access to world-class education and modern learning facilities.
According to the proposal, the new institutions will follow the educational philosophy and quality benchmarks associated with Aitchison College. The schools will focus on academic excellence, character development, leadership skills, discipline, and extracurricular activities.
Officials said the institutions will be equipped with modern classrooms, science laboratories, computer facilities, libraries, and sports infrastructure. Creating such institutions across Punjab will help bridge the gap between elite private schools and government educational institutions.
Moreover, special emphasis will also be placed on recruiting highly qualified teachers. The schools are expected to deliver an education system comparable to leading institutions and promote merit-based admissions.
Authorities stated that the schools will gradually be established throughout Punjab, allowing students from different socioeconomic backgrounds to benefit from quality education.
On the other hand, previously, Punjab Boards Committee of Chairmen (PBCC) announced the result schedule for the 2026 annual Matric and Intermediate examinations across all educational boards in the province.
According to the schedule, the Matric Part II, which is the 10th class, results will be announced on August 6, 2026. Afterwards, the results of Matric Part I, which is the 9th class, will be announced on September 2, 2026.
The Intermediate Part II, which is the 12th class or the second year, results will be announced on September 23, 2026.
Additionally, the results for the Intermediate Part I, which is the 11th class or the first year of college, will be announced on October 22, 2026.
The schedule also stated that supplementary examinations for Matric students who fail one or more subjects will begin on October 6, 2026.
